NJI, CIBN TO MEET ON BANKING SECTOR REFORM

By NBF News

The National Judicial Institute and the Chartered Institute of Bankers of Nigeria will gather key players in the judicial and banking systems to deliberate on critical banking and legal issues that will further strengthen the ongoing banking sector reform.

This is coming under the auspices of the National Seminar on Banking and Allied Matters for Judges, which is usually put together by the CIBN and NJI on an annual basis, a statement from the CIBN on Tuesday said.

The seminar, with the theme: 'Banking Reforms and Economic Stability in Nigeria,' will hold in Abuja from December 7- 9.

The programme, according to CIBN, is designed to provide a forum for top banking industry operators and judges to crossfertilise ideas on contemporary banking and related judicial matters for the soundness of the banking industry and the development of the economy.

The two bodies have assembled seasoned experts from the judiciary and the financial sector of the economy to address the gathering.
